Ben Chester

Assistant Director, Pro Scouting

Biography

Ben Chester enters his 12th season with the Raiders and second season as the Assistant Director of Pro Scouting. He spent his first 10 seasons with the Raiders as a Pro Scout after originally joining the organization in 2014. In his current role, Chester assists the player personnel department in various areas: evaluating both professional and college players, advance scouting of upcoming opponents, directing in-season tryouts, assisting in setting the free agency board, and attending college pro days. Prior to his time with the Silver and Black, Chester was a defensive graduate assistant for the UW-Stevens Point football team and a football operations assistant/pro liaison at UW-Oshkosh.

A native of Green Bay, Wisc., Chester graduated from UW-Green Bay with a degree in business administration and received his master's degree from UW-Stevens Point in Education. He was a member of the Ripon College football team before having a few stints as a quarterback in the Indoor Football League. Chester resides in Las Vegas with his wife, Amy and two boys (Charlie and Malcolm).
